The Role

About the Role

As our GTM Analytics & Strategy hire, you will play a critical role in shaping how Shepherd grows and scales. You’ll work across datasets and systems spanning GTM, underwriting, product, and operations to surface insights that inform strategy, execution, and resource allocation.

This is a high-impact, high-visibility role with direct exposure to company leadership. You’ll partner closely with teams across Shepherd to evaluate key business questions, identify growth and efficiency levers, and translate data into clear, actionable recommendations.

We value working together in person and are looking for candidates who can be onsite at our San Francisco HQ.

Responsibilities

  • Develop a deep understanding of Shepherd’s business model, GTM motion, and operating cadence to support data-driven decision-making

  • Lead analytical deep dives on core GTM and business questions, identifying patterns, risks, and opportunities across pipeline, conversion, and performance

  • Identify, develop, and maintain key performance indicators to measure GTM health, efficiency, and revenue growth

  • Create and own dashboards and reports using SQL and BI tools to support leadership and functional teams

  • Support internal and external reporting requirements, including executive, board, and partner-facing analyses

  • Understand and meet key stakeholders’ ongoing analytics needs and deliver actionable, data-driven recommendations

  • Design and analyze experiments to test hypotheses and identify scalable growth levers (e.g., activities, segmentation, capacity allocation, GTM prioritization)

  • Maintain, optimize, and establish best practices for BI and GTM tooling

  • Ensure data quality and integrity through robust validation and QA processes

You would be our dream candidate if…

  • 5+ years of experience in analytics, business intelligence, data science, management consulting, or a related field

    • Bonus: experience with revenue, sales, or GTM analytics in a high-growth environment

  • Strong proficiency in SQL (required); experience with Python is a plus

  • Advanced Excel skills and experience with modern BI and data visualization tools

  • Experience analyzing and synthesizing data across Salesforce (CRM) and GTM tooling (e.g., Outreach) to inform pipeline strategy and execution

  • Experience supporting GTM performance management, including quota setting and sales performance tracking

  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to clearly articulate insights and business implications to technical and non-technical audiences

  • A high bar for accuracy, rigor, and polish in analytical work

  • Strong business acumen and comfort operating in ambiguity

  • Proven ability to prioritize effectively and manage multiple workstreams in a fast-paced environment

  • A collaborative, low-ego mindset and experience working cross-functionally
